UNIFYD TV Streaming Service: An Accessible Choice for On-Demand Entertainment

In the ever-expanding universe of online streaming, UNIFYD TV stakes its claim as a straightforward, subscription-based platform focused on movies, TV shows, and educational content. Since its launch in 2019, it has carved a niche in North America and Europe, primarily catering to English-speaking audiences. Based on its engineering data, the service emphasizes editorial curation and a steady monthly update cycle, making it appealing for content enthusiasts looking for fresh videos regularly without the clutter of live streaming or offline watching options. But does it truly stand out in a market flooded with on-demand platforms? Let's break down the measurable features!

Detailed Specs & Features That Define UNIFYD TV

On paper, UNIFYD TV offers a subscription-based streaming model that avoids free tiers or trials, demanding upfront commitment from users. It supports HD streaming resolution with compatibility for SD as well, although it excludes HDR content, which limits its video quality in comparison to services boasting 4K or HDR. It streams via common video compression standards like H.264 at frame rates of 24fps or 30fps, delivering smooth playback suitable for standard screens and devices.

The platform supports multiple devices, including Web browsers, iOS and Android apps, smart TVs running Android TV or Roku TV operating systems, and even streaming devices with casting options such as Chromecast and AirPlay. This broad compatibility reflects a customer-centric strategy focused on ease of access across popular hardware.

One notable feature from the specs is the adaptive bitrate streaming, which helps optimize data usage and streaming continuity even on network fluctuations, backed by a moderate minimum bandwidth requirement of 5 Mbps. However, the service does not support offline viewing, which may affect users with intermittent internet connectivity. Additionally, the availability of on-demand streaming is emphasized. Still, it lacks live streaming options and sports or kids content, meaning it caters more to general entertainment and educational viewers than niche audiences.

Design & Build

The user interface embraces a content-first approach with a tab-based navigation structure, allowing users to move smoothly between categories such as movies, TV shows, and documentaries. According to specs, the design is simple, promoting ease of discovery over flashy visuals or advanced customization. Features like a watchlist, continued watching, and content progress tracking are present, enhancing engagement despite the absence of more advanced options like playback customization or voice control.

Performance

In daily use, the streaming quality is expected to be stable and user-friendly thanks to adaptive bitrate streaming and data optimization features. The service offers standard stereo audio without surround sound or audio description capabilities, which, while common, limits immersive or accessibility-enriched experiences. The subtitle support without customization helps reach a broader audience, though it's relatively basic.

The platform's account management system is quite standard; users need an account, with login authentication handled through email and password, but there is no social login or multi-profile support. Account sharing policies are limited, which aligns with subscription-based services' trend to control simultaneous streams, though no explicit limits are stated.

Extra Features

While UNIFYD TV lacks some bells and whistles like offline viewing, multi-profile support, or social community features, it does provide an editorially curated content library updated monthly. Exclusive content combined with third-party movies and shows enriches the overall catalog. The user experience benefits from a recommendation engine with basic personalization and genre-based discovery, but misses out on advanced features such as mood-based discovery or transparent algorithms.
